Living in a studio or shoebox apartment? Your home office setup doesn't need to scream "luxury" to work well. Start with a vertical monitor arm to free up desk space—no more towering stacks of books. Pair it with a compact mechanical keyboard (60% layout) to avoid the "clutter creep" of full-sized peripherals. For noise control, a $15 foam wedge panel behind your monitor cuts echo better than most "premium" acoustic panels. Lastly, use a cable sleeve (not just zip ties) to bundle cords into a single clean line—your future self will thank you during cleaning. Small space, big focus.
